Transaction 63ae33589c60729560a7a9301b94c2907e773d42bbc6134d9bf379605bd52a9e
1 Input
1 Output
-
63ae33589c60729560a7a9301b94c2907e773d42bbc6134d9bf379605bd52a9e:0
- value
- 9665045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25384a9d88b4debd47f8f20b3784b34d90aae11e OP_EQUAL
- address
- 355pMqjo6gAwwGYR4LVZFRpU3eAym3RXDk